VIC Emergency Backstop Mechanism
SCOPE
This document describes the process of how to configure a Fronius inverter system to comply with the AEMO directive for Victoria's Emergency backstop Mechanism for Solar.
The following inverter series are relevant to this document:
- Fronius Primo & Symo GEN24 and GEN24 Plus
- Fronius Verto
- Fronius Tauro & Tauro ECO
- Fronius SnapINverter Primo, Symo, ECO, Galvo
GENERAL
Stage 1 of the emergency backstop will commence on the 1.October 2024, new, upgraded or replacement solar systems (less or equal to 200kW) must comply.
